Day 2: Shanghai

Sightseeing and Activities: Shanghai Museum, Former French Concession, Shanghai World Financial Center, Nanjing Road, the Bund, Huangpu River cruise
Accommodation: Shanghai
Meals: Breakfast, Lunch

After breakfast, we will first visit Shanghai Museum. It is the Museum of Ancient Chinese Art with more than 120,000 precious and rare works of art. Then, walk through the Former French Concession which was once designated for the French. The tree-lined avenues and their many Tudor mansions in the area still retain an air of the “Paris of the East”.

Later, drive to visit Shanghai World Financial Center to have a panoramic view of the whole Shanghai and Huangpu River area. After that, head to Nanjing Road and the Bund. In the evening, you can choose to take Huangpu River cruise to enjoy fantastic night view of Shanghai(optional).

Day 3: Shanghai – Suzhou

Sightseeing and Activities: Tongli Water Town, Lingering Garden
Accommodation: Suzhou
Meals: Breakfast, Lunch

Today we will drive about 75 minutes to visit the famous Tongli Water Town. It is characterized by stone bridges and well preserved ancient architecture, including private gardens, temples and houses. You’ll visit the Tuisi Yuan, Pearl Pagoda, Triple Bridge, Ming and Qing Dynasty Street, etc.

Then drive another 30 minutes to visit Lingering Garden in Suzhou, one of the four most famous gardens in China, listed as World Culture Heritage by UNESCO. After that, we will visit the First Silk Factory to learn Chinese silk culture.

Then check in your hotel in Suzhou city.

Day 4: Suzhou – Hangzhou

Sightseeing and Activities: West Lake, Viewing Fish at flower Pond, Flying Peak, Lingyin Temple, Meijia Dock Longjing Tea Village, China National Tea Museum
Accommodation: Hangzhou
Meals: Breakfast, Lunch

Get up early to catch the high speed train to Hangzhou. Upon your arrival, your tour guide will pick you up from the railway station and start today’s sightseeing.

We will first visit the picturesque West Lake and have a cruise to enjoy the scenery of this famous tranquil lake. After the cruise, we will stroll on the famous Su Causeway and Bai Causeway, as well as the sites around, such as Viewing Fish at flower Pond.

Then we will move to Flying Peak and Lingyin Temple. It is one of the most famous ancient Buddhist temples in China, home to numerous pagodas and Buddhist grottoes.

After that, visit Meijia Dock Longjing Tea Village. Longjing tea is Hangzhou’s most famous products and one of China’s best teas. You can visit China National Tea Museum to learn Chinese Tea Culture.

Day 5: Hangzhou – Shanghai

Sightseeing and Activities: Six Harmonies Pagoda
Accommodation: Shanghai
Meals: Breakfast, Lunch

After breakfast, visit Six Harmonies Pagoda, a perfect symbol of brick-and-wood structure built in 970 AD. Climbing onto the top, you could have a spectacular view of Qiantang River and surrounding hills.

Then, be free until your guide and driver escort you to take a high speed train to Shanghai.
